file-type

Jenkins终极指南英文PDF完整教程

ZIP文件

5星 · 超过95%的资源 | 下载需积分: 10 | 20.68MB | 更新于2025-05-26 | 174 浏览量 | 4 下载量 举报 收藏
download 立即下载
Jenkins是一款开源的自动化服务器,主要用于自动化各种任务,例如构建、测试和部署软件。它能够持续、自动地构建和测试软件项目,从而加快软件开发流程,提高软件开发的质量和效率。Jenkins支持广泛的构建工具和版本控制系统,且具有灵活的插件生态系统,能够集成多种开发工具和项目管理工具,因此被广泛应用于持续集成(Continuous Integration,简称CI)和持续部署(Continuous Deployment,简称CD)的实践中。 《Jenkins: The Definitive Guide》是一本关于Jenkins的权威指南,它详细地介绍了如何安装、配置以及使用Jenkins。这本书不仅适合初学者,也适合那些需要深入了解Jenkins高级功能的开发者和系统管理员。本书通常会涵盖以下内容: 1. Jenkins基础:介绍Jenkins的基本概念,包括持续集成的概念、Jenkins的工作原理、Jenkins的安装和配置。 2. Jenkins的安装:详细说明如何在不同操作系统上安装Jenkins,如何配置必要的环境,以及如何启动和停止Jenkins服务。 3. 构建和测试:介绍如何使用Jenkins创建构建任务,如何使用各种插件进行代码的编译、测试和打包等。 4. 自动化:讲解如何设置自动化流程,例如定时构建、触发器配置、自动化部署等。 5. 管理和安全:说明如何管理Jenkins,包括用户权限控制、安全设置、插件管理、备份和恢复等。 6. 插件的使用:详细介绍Jenkins插件的安装、配置和使用,如邮件发送插件、代码质量分析插件等。 7. 高级功能:探讨如何利用Jenkins的高级功能,如云集成(在云平台上部署Jenkins)、分布式构建等。 8. 故障排除:提供一些常见的问题解决方法和故障排除技巧,帮助用户快速解决在使用Jenkins时可能遇到的问题。 9. 脚本化管道:介绍Jenkins Pipeline的使用,这是一种用代码的形式来定义和实现持续集成的流程,可以用来创建复杂的自动化任务。 10. 案例研究:通过实际案例展示如何将Jenkins应用到具体的项目和环境中,以提供实际的参考。 由于《Jenkins: The Definitive Guide》是一本英文原版书籍,它采用英文撰写,因此读者需要具备一定的英文阅读能力。对于希望通过阅读英文原版书籍深入了解Jenkins的IT专业人员来说,这本书是一个非常好的学习资料。通过阅读本书,读者可以全面地掌握Jenkins的安装、配置、使用和维护等各项技能,进而在实际工作中应用这些知识来优化软件开发流程。

相关推荐

世外千年
  • 粉丝: 2
上传资源 快速赚钱